Output 67fb6a2d8d1731ec64530fa9146e14855afc29e4bc54258eb5b2507c99e21a91:3

value
317526
script pubkey
OP_0 OP_PUSHBYTES_20 004e2c256e6fd99e43d20d4f303d93a890c96eae
address
bc1qqp8zcftwdlveus7jp48nq0vn4zgvjm4wm8d3d0
transaction
67fb6a2d8d1731ec64530fa9146e14855afc29e4bc54258eb5b2507c99e21a91
spent
true